[0034] The present invention decomposes network protocol functions into multiple atomic functions according to the three logical domains of connection, service quality and security, which are called meta-services. Several service containers are set on network nodes, and each service container manages and organizes a group with the same The protocol unit of the interface, each protocol unit corresponds to a meta-service, and completes the corresponding network function. Abstract

The invention relates to an implementation method for network node structure supporting service customization and expansion, which comprises the following steps of: adopting a service container to replace the protocol stack in the traditional network system structure; adopting a deployable protocol unit and a dynamic combination thereof to replace the original series of protocols; providing a service interface for network application by the service container and receives the customizing request of the network application upon the network service, and the inner part realizes and provides the customizing service through an organization management unit; and providing a deployment interface to a service provider by the service container, dynamically loading or downloading the protocol unit, and implementing the dynamic expansion of the network function through the downloading of the protocol unit. In the invention, the network application can obtain the network service equal to the traditional network system structure and also can obtain more flexible service support by putting forwarding the service customization request facing to the requirements in the aspects of connection, service quality and the safety from the service container, and the service of the service container can be flexibly expanded.

technical field [0001] The invention belongs to the technical field of computer networks, and relates to a network node system, which is used to provide customizable and scalable network transmission services. It is a network node structure implementation method that supports service customization and expansion, and can be deployed on network end nodes or intermediate nodes. superior. Background technique [0002] The network architecture stipulates the information interaction, access control, connection mode and topology between network equipment and terminal equipment, and is embodied in a series of protocols and standards. The currently widely used TCP / IP five-layer network structure was formed in the 1970s. Its layered structure and based on the idea of ​​best effort and packet forwarding can better solve the design problems of complex communication protocols and provide certain scalability. and higher efficiency.
